2. Software program Proficiency
Software program proficiency is a cornerstone of training at any sport and expertise academy. Mastery of related software program just isn’t merely a technical talent, however a basic prerequisite for efficient creation, problem-solving, and innovation throughout the fields of interactive leisure and technological growth. This proficiency allows college students to translate conceptual concepts into tangible merchandise and contribute meaningfully to team-based tasks.
-
Recreation Engines: Unity and Unreal Engine
These are the {industry} requirements for sport growth. Proficiency in both engine permits college students to prototype, develop, and deploy interactive experiences throughout numerous platforms. Unity’s versatility and ease of use make it splendid for fast prototyping and smaller-scale tasks, whereas Unreal Engine’s graphical constancy and superior options cater to high-end productions. A graduate missing competence in a minimum of one in every of these engines faces vital challenges in securing employment as a sport developer.
-
Digital Content material Creation (DCC) Software program: Maya, Blender, and Substance Painter
These instruments are essential for creating 3D fashions, textures, and animations. Maya, broadly utilized in skilled studios, affords sturdy modeling and animation instruments. Blender, an open-source various, supplies a complete characteristic set and a big neighborhood. Substance Painter permits for the creation of high-quality textures and supplies. The flexibility to create visually compelling belongings is significant for sport artwork and design college students.
-
Programming Languages: C#, C++, and Python
C# is the first language for Unity growth, whereas C++ is important for Unreal Engine and performance-critical duties. Python is regularly used for scripting, automation, and information evaluation. Fluency in a minimum of one programming language permits college students to implement sport mechanics, create synthetic intelligence, and develop instruments. With out programming expertise, a scholar’s inventive imaginative and prescient is restricted by accessible belongings and pre-built functionalities.
-
Model Management Techniques: Git
Git and platforms like GitHub are indispensable for collaborative software program growth. Proficiency in model management permits college students to handle code adjustments, collaborate successfully on tasks, and monitor mission historical past. This talent is important for working in groups and contributes to environment friendly mission administration. A scarcity of familiarity with model management can result in chaotic workflows and mission failures.

6. Venture administration
Venture administration constitutes a significant skillset throughout the curriculum of a sport and expertise academy. Its significance stems from the collaborative and interdisciplinary nature of sport growth and expertise tasks, which invariably demand structured approaches to planning, execution, and supply. With out proficient mission administration, even probably the most gifted people can battle to coordinate their efforts successfully, resulting in missed deadlines, price range overruns, and compromised product high quality.
-
Planning and Scheduling
Efficient mission administration necessitates meticulous planning and lifelike scheduling. This includes defining mission scope, breaking down duties into manageable items, estimating timelines, and allocating sources appropriately. In a sport growth context, this may entail outlining the assorted phases of growth, from idea artwork and prototyping to programming and testing, and assigning particular roles and obligations to crew members. A poorly deliberate schedule can lead to a domino impact of delays and elevated stress for the event crew. For instance, a failure to account for the time required for asset creation can push again programming deadlines, jeopardizing the general mission timeline.
-
Useful resource Allocation
Venture administration includes the strategic allocation of sources, together with personnel, tools, and price range. Inside an academy setting, this may occasionally contain assigning college students to particular mission roles based mostly on their skillsets, securing entry to crucial software program licenses and {hardware}, and managing mission expenditures inside budgetary constraints. Environment friendly useful resource allocation minimizes waste and ensures that the mission crew has the instruments and assist wanted to succeed. Insufficient useful resource allocation can result in bottlenecks and hinder mission progress. For instance, limiting entry to movement seize tools can impede the event of lifelike character animations.
-
Danger Administration
Venture administration entails figuring out and mitigating potential dangers that might impede mission progress. This includes anticipating challenges, growing contingency plans, and proactively addressing points earlier than they escalate. Within the context of sport growth, potential dangers embody technical difficulties, scope creep, and personnel turnover. A proactive danger administration technique can reduce the impression of those challenges and maintain the mission on monitor. Failure to anticipate dangers can lead to vital setbacks. For instance, the invention of a vital software program bug late within the growth cycle can necessitate in depth rework and delay the mission launch.
-
Communication and Collaboration
Efficient mission administration hinges on clear communication and seamless collaboration amongst crew members. This includes establishing communication channels, facilitating common conferences, and using mission administration software program to trace progress and share info. In a sport growth surroundings, efficient communication ensures that artists, programmers, designers, and different crew members are aligned on mission targets and may successfully coordinate their efforts. Poor communication can result in misunderstandings, conflicts, and in the end, mission failure. For instance, an absence of communication between designers and programmers can lead to the implementation of sport mechanics that don’t align with the unique design imaginative and prescient.
